Play Kingdom Rush
Kingdom Rush
TOWER DEFENSE STRATEGY DEFENSE
22,052,239 plays
Play Incursion
Incursion
TOWER DEFENSE STRATEGY DEFENSE
3,128,392 plays
Play Mushroom Madness 3
Mushroom Madness 3
DEFENSE UPGRADES ANIMAL
1,963,774 plays
Play Infectonator 2
Infectonator 2
ZOMBIE VIRUS PIXEL
6,379,606 plays
See all recently played »